Transaction 31487786d4af018823ea709031c21c8f57744a8b7771bdf2c09d80bd829ef0f6
1 Input
1 Output
-
31487786d4af018823ea709031c21c8f57744a8b7771bdf2c09d80bd829ef0f6:0
- value
- 443212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95b0aeed6aca5dfcd77090512e36714553d72a97 OP_EQUAL
- address
- 3FLWGJF3W32ASnfdjVviMJbrqvP9UyNKPM